Understand competitive sustainability with our comprehensive supply chain and moat analysis tools for long-term investing. Pediatrix Medical Group Inc. (MD), a leading provider of physician services specializing in maternal-fetal medicine, neonatology, and pediatric cardiology, recently released its first quarter 2026 financial results. The company reported earnings per share of $0.44 on revenue of approximately $1.91 billion for the quarter ended March 2026.
